Overview
The 74HC4052D/AU118, produced by NXP USA Inc., is a dual 4-channel analog multiplexer/demultiplexer. This high-speed Si-gate CMOS device is designed for use in both analog and digital multiplexing and demultiplexing applications. It features two independent multiplexers, each with four channels, and a common select logic. The device is known for its wide analog input voltage range, low ON resistance, and high noise immunity, making it versatile for various electronic systems.
Key Specifications
| Parameter | Value | Unit |
|---|---|---|
| No. of Channels | 8 (2 x 4 channels) | |
| Supply Voltage Range | 2.0 V to 10.0 V | V |
| Operating Temperature Range | -40°C to +125°C | °C |
| On Resistance Rds(on) | 80 Ω (typical) at VCC - VEE = 4.5 V | Ω |
| Output Current Max | 20 mA | mA |
| Package Type | SO16 (SOT109-1) | |
| No. of Pins | 16 | |
| Logic Type | CMOS | |
| ESD Protection | HBM: ANSI/ESDA/JEDEC JS-001 class 2 exceeds 2000 V, CDM: ANSI/ESDA/JEDEC JS-002 class C3 exceeds 1000 V | V |
Key Features
- Wide Analog Input Voltage Range: From -5 V to +5 V, allowing for a broad range of analog signal handling.
- Low ON Resistance: Typical values of 80 Ω at VCC - VEE = 4.5 V, 70 Ω at VCC - VEE = 6.0 V, and 60 Ω at VCC - VEE = 9.0 V.
- Logic Level Translation: Enables 5 V logic to communicate with ±5 V analog signals.
- ‘Break Before Make’ Built-in: Ensures that the old channel is disconnected before the new one is connected.
- High Noise Immunity: Provides robust performance in noisy environments.
- ESD Protection: High-level ESD protection according to ANSI/ESDA/JEDEC standards.
Applications
- Analog Multiplexing and Demultiplexing: Ideal for switching between multiple analog signals.
- Digital Multiplexing and Demultiplexing: Suitable for digital signal routing and selection.
- Signal Gating: Can be used to control the flow of signals in various electronic circuits.
